Lincoln is 4-0 against Tipton since April of 2018,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Lincoln Cardinals will be playing at home against the Tipton Cardinals at 3:00 p.m. Lincoln will be strutting in after a win while Tipton will be coming in after a loss.
Lincoln is hoping to deliver their fans another blowout on Thursday, just like they did against Green Ridge (and have done all season long). Lincoln never let Green Ridge onto the board and left with a 6-0 victory on Tuesday. The win made it back-to-back victories for Lincoln.
Alyssa Mellen was excellent, scoring a run while going 3-for-4. Greenlea Harms was another key contributor, scoring a run and stealing a base while going 2-for-4.
Meanwhile, Tipton was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their sixth straight defeat. They lost 16-2 to Crest Ridge.
Tipton sa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Anna Crane, who scored a run while going 1-for-3.
Lincoln is on a roll lately: they've won four of their last five matchups, which provided a massive bump to their 12-8 record this season. As for Tipton, their loss dropped their record down to 4-13.
Everything went Lincoln's way against Tipton in their previous matchup back in April as Lincoln made off with a 14-6 win. Does Lincoln have another victory up their sleeve, or will Tipton tur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
